Community Meeting at Poway City Council Chambers to Address Home Owners Insurance in Fire Zones

Homeowner’s insurance in a fire zone will be discussed at the Poway City Council Chambers at 7 pm Thursday, Nov. 14. Sponsored by the Poway Neighborhood Emergency Corps (PNEC), the meeting will address questions regarding insurance renewal or cancellation due to living in a Fire Zone. Insurance options that people may not have considered will be discussed at the meeting, even if they have received an insurance non renewal notice.
